setting fish shell panicked at shell oppening
Setting the configuration setting to my fish shell path 'usr/bin/fish' gave this error at shell opening
thread 'main' panicked at 'called
Result::unwrap()
on anErr
value: Error { domain: g-io-error-quark, code: 1, message: "Impossible d’exécuter le processus fils «\u{a0}usr/bin/fish\u{a0}»\u{a0}: Failed to execve: Aucun fichier ou dossier de ce type" }', src/tau/src/main_win.rs:1205:10 note: run withRUST_BACKTRACE=1
environment variable to display a backtrace
Remarks:
- this error then reoccurs at next tau launch. And I didn't found a way to recover from it.
- I didn't add any chars after nor before 'usr/bin/fish' (without quotes) and certainly not \u{a0}.
